Facebook Starting To Charge - We have actually heard our whole lives that there's no such point as a freebie, so it's just natural for individuals to suspect Facebook may start charging for its solution. This report appears particularly plausible when you take into consideration debates like the one Slate publication author Farhad Manjoo presented in a column from 2008. Manjoo explained that if even 5 percent of Facebook individuals agreed to pay $5 a month for the service (with the staying individuals reduced to minimal accounts), Facebook might generate numerous millions of dollars a year in subscription fees alone.

The good news is for Facebook individuals, the business currently has no strategies to start charging for the solution. According to a Service Week interview with Facebook COO Sheryl Sandberg, Facebook pays as well as growing promptly based just on the strength of its advertising and marketing profits. So while it's hard to search in to the future as well as state with assurance what Facebook's company version will look like, for the time being Facebook addicts can keep their cash in their wallets when they browse through. Don't worry, the social networks website is not going to start charging you. Facebook also created an assistance web page just to state this: "Facebook is a totally free website and also will never ever require that you pay to proceed making use of the site."

The web page after that takes place to clarify that, yes, you might pay money for some video games as well as various other applications you play on the website. As well as if you review your smart phone's information restriction while making use of Facebook, you'll need to pay for that, too.
